Car-Free Jamsugyo Bridge: Seoul’s Ultimate Strolling Festival

Car-Free Jamsugyo Bridge: Seoul
  • 📅 Date: April 26, 2026 ~ June 14, 2026
  • 📍 Venue: Jamsugyo Bridge
  • 🗺️ Address: 서울특별시 서초구 반포동
Step into a unique urban wonderland at the Car-Free Jamsugyo Bridge Strolling Festival, a vibrant cultural celebration transforming one of Seoul’s iconic waterways into a pedestrian paradise. For a limited time, the Jamsugyo Bridge sheds its vehicular hustle, inviting locals and tourists alike to experience the Han River and cityscapes from an entirely new perspective. This remarkable event offers a refreshing escape from the everyday, providing an unparalleled opportunity to connect with Seoul’s culture and community in an unforgettable setting.

Visitors can anticipate a rich tapestry of experiences designed to delight all senses. The festival often features an eclectic mix of live performances, from traditional Korean music and dance to contemporary street acts, creating a dynamic backdrop to your stroll. Beyond the entertainment, you’ll discover various art installations, interactive workshops, and a mouth-watering array of food trucks serving up both local delights and international flavors. The car-free environment allows for leisurely exploration, perfect for capturing stunning photos of the Han River, the surrounding cityscape, and the lively festival goers.
